Skip to content

Download Computer Graphics Using Java 2D and 3D by Cay S. Horstmann, Gary Cornell PDF

By Cay S. Horstmann, Gary Cornell

This Java guide makes a realistic educational on Java second and Java 3D for machine pros. It comprises in-depth insurance of simple special effects strategies and strategies, and introduces complex photograph good points to an viewers usually informed within the Java language. bankruptcy issues contain mathematical historical past for special effects, .geometric transformation, perspectives, lights and texturing, habit and interplay, and animation. For laptop programmers and engineers, info analysts, picture designers/animators, and online game builders.

Show description

Read or Download Computer Graphics Using Java 2D and 3D PDF

Best computers books

Idiot's Guides: Apple Watch

Combining in-depth info and easy-to-understand full-color directions, Idiot's publications: Apple Watch can be simply as crucial to an Apple Watch user's adventure because the iPhone, which has to be utilized in conjunction with Apple Watch.

This invaluable booklet covers the new Watch OS consumer interface and obviously exhibits you ways to: attach your iPhone on your Apple Watch and Apple television; customise your Watch to fit your wishes; video display your calendar and agenda; entry iTunes out of your wrist through Bluetooth; comprise your Watch into your overall healthiness and health routine; use Siri that can assist you with projects, messaging, and extra; paintings with third-party apps to augment your event; and lots more and plenty extra!

Proceedings of the 3rd International Scientific Conference of Students and Young Scientists "Theoretical and Applied Aspects of Cybernetics" TAAC-2013

Complaints of the third foreign medical convention of scholars and younger Scientists “Theoretical and utilized points of Cybernetics” TAAC-2013, November 25-29, 2013, Kyiv, Ukraine.

Extra info for Computer Graphics Using Java 2D and 3D

Sample text

Two perpendicular axes are placed in the plane. Each axis is labeled with the set of real numbers. The horizontal axis is customarily called the x-axis and the vertical axis the y-axis. The intersection of the axes is identified with the number 0 on both axes and is called the origin. Each point on the plane is associated with a pair of real numbers (x, y) known as the x-coordinate and the y-coordinate. The coordinates measure the horizontal and vertical position of the point relative to the axes.

The rendering of the scene is done automatically by the Java 3D engine. 11. The concepts and techniques of programming Java 3D with scene graphs will be introduced in the later chapters. The program is also constructed as a dual-purpose applet/application. The class Demo3D is defined as a subclass of Applet. A main method also exists in Demo3D to run the class as an application. The utility class MainFrame (line 16) included in Java 3D provides the necessary functionality to run an applet in a frame.

4. An ellipse can be represented by a quadratic equation. UNREGISTERED VERSION OF CHM TO PDF CONVERTER PRO The collection of all points or coordinates is also known as a space. Three types of spaces are typically involved in a graphics system: object space, world space, and device space. Each space is usually characterized by its own coordinate system. Geometric objects in one space can be mapped to another by transformations. An object coordinate system, also known as local or modeling coordinate system, is associated with the definition of a particular graphics object or primitive.

Download PDF sample

Rated 4.38 of 5 – based on 29 votes